The Power of Mindful Eating for Enhancing Mental Well-being

In today's fast-paced world, many of us find ourselves rushing through meals, eating on the go, or mindlessly consuming food while focusing on other tasks. This disconnected way of eating not only impacts our physical health but also takes a toll on our mental well-being.

What is Mindful Eating?

Mindful eating is a practice that involves paying full attention to the experience of eating and drinking, both inside and outside the body. It involves being fully present in the moment, using all your senses to savor, taste, and enjoy each bite without judgment or distraction.

Benefits of Mindful Eating for Mental Well-being

  • Reduced Stress: Mindful eating can help reduce stress levels by focusing on the present moment and cultivating a sense of calm and awareness.
  • Improved Relationship with Food: By being mindful of your eating habits, you can develop a healthier relationship with food, free from guilt or emotional eating patterns.
  • Enhanced Emotional Regulation: Practicing mindful eating can improve your ability to regulate emotions and cope with stress, leading to better mental well-being.
  • Increased Satisfaction: By paying attention to the flavors and textures of food, you can experience greater satisfaction from your meals, leading to a more positive mood.

Tips for Practicing Mindful Eating

  1. Avoid distractions such as phones, computers, or TV while eating.
  2. Take time to appreciate the colors, smells, and textures of your food before taking a bite.
  3. Chew slowly and savor each mouthful, noticing the flavors and sensations.
  4. Listen to your body's hunger and fullness cues to guide your eating decisions.
  5. Express gratitude for the nourishment and pleasure that food provides.
